  3. Some NDE's known as "Peak in Darien" Experiences involve the experiencer interacting with dead people who were still thought to be alive at the time, or were complete strangers to the experiencer.

    For example, Cardiologist Pim Van Lommel from the Netherlands has documented the extensive NDE of a Dutch man who, while undergoing cardiac arrest, saw his deceased grandmother and a man who looked at him lovingly, but whom he could not recognize. Over a decade after his NDE, his mother, on her deathbed, confessed to him that he'd been born from an extramarital relationship, and that her husband was not his real father. His biological father was actually a Jewish man who had been deported and killed during World War II. She also showed her son a photograph of his biological father, and he immediately recognized him as the man he'd seen in his NDE a decade earlier.
